New design of cationic alkyl glycoglycerolipids toxic to tumor cells

Abstract: New glycosylated alkyl glycerolipids bearing a cationic group at the C6 position of sugar moiety have been synthesized and tested as potential anticancer drugs. The compounds demonstrated cytotoxicity and selectivity against tumor cells at low micromolar concentration.
